A perfect example of how two styles of music can come together to create something familiar yet unique. Although seldom used, the harmonica feels right at home in ska and reggae, even if only a vacation home. Here's a few of my favorites:

Joe Higgs "Upside Down"

Toots & The Maytals "Reggae Got Soul"

Bob Marley & The Wailers "Talkin' Blues" and "Rebel Music (3 O'Clock Roadblock)"

Big Youth "Some Like It Dread"

Black Uhuru "There is Fire"

Keith Hudson "Melody Maker"

Charlie “Organaire” Cameron & Roy Richards

Hi
I'm a big ska and reggae fan and after buying a cd called "Trojan Battlefield" filled with Jamaican R&B I got interested in a harmonicaplayer called Charlie “Organaire” Cameron. Roy Richards, a blind harmonica player also plays on lots of "Treasure Island" and "Studio One" recordings. Charlie Organair's "Little Holiday"is one of my favorites.
